The 2004 UTfit Collaboration Report on the Status of the Unitarity Triangle in the Standard Model

Abstract

Using the latest determinations of several theoretical and experimental parameters, we update the Unitarity Triangle analysis in the Standard Model. The basic experimental constraints come from the measurements of |Vub/Vcb|, Delta Md, the lower limit on Delta Ms, epsilonk, and the measurement of the phase of the Bd - anti Bd mixing amplitude through the time-dependent CP asymmetry in B0 to J/psi K0 decays. In addition, we consider the direct determination of alpha, gamma, 2 beta + gamma and cos(2 beta) from the measurements of new CP-violating quantities, recently performed at the B factories. We also discuss the opportunities offered by improving the precision of the various physical quantities entering in the determination of the Unitarity Triangle parameters.
